Vortioxetine Hydrobromide is a molecule with a specific structure, classified as a serotonin modulator and stimulator. Its chemical name is 1-[2-[(2,4-Dimethylphenyl)thio]phenyl]piperazine hydrobromide, with the CAS number 960203-27-4. The 'hydrobromide' in its name indicates that it is the salt form of vortioxetine, which often enhances solubility and stability – critical attributes for pharmaceutical formulations. The precise molecular formula and weight are vital for stoichiometric calculations in synthesis and dosage calculations.
The purity of Vortioxetine Hydrobromide is paramount. Pharmaceutical-grade material typically requires a purity of 99% or higher, with strict limits on impurities. Understanding the impurity profile is essential, as even trace amounts of certain by-products can affect the drug's safety and efficacy, and may contribute to unexpected vortioxetine hydrobromide side effects. Detailed analytical data, often obtained through techniques like HPLC, NMR, and mass spectrometry, are necessary to confirm the vortioxetine hydrobromide chemical properties.
The vortioxetine hydrobromide mechanism of action involves its interaction with various serotonin receptors and transporters. This biological activity is directly linked to its chemical structure. Modifications to this structure can alter its binding affinity and efficacy, making precise chemical synthesis and characterization indispensable. The compound's physical form, often a white to off-white powder, is also a key characteristic relevant to its handling and formulation.

The stability of Vortioxetine Hydrobromide under various conditions (temperature, light, humidity) is another vital chemical property. Proper storage and handling, guided by an understanding of these properties, are essential to maintain its potency and safety throughout the supply chain and during its use in pharmaceutical manufacturing.
